    There are a couple of things that might be causing your problem. Some of the specific remedies might be dependent on which computer operating system you are using though.

    If you are running Microsoft Windows XP, consider installing Service Pack 2. Click the "Help and Support" link on the "start" button menu for a link to Windows "automatic updates".

    Some computers using Microsoft's Windows operating system are vulnerable to fraudulent security alerts though a messenger service intended for Local Area Network (LAN) administrators. Note that this is a different thing from the instant messenger clients many people utilize to converse with their friends. Click the "Shields Up!!" link at   Home of Gibson Research Corporation   for a networking port security test and advice about configuring you network router or/or software firewall to guard against messenger spam.

    You should also check your computer using an online virus scanner like Trend Micro HouseCall - Free Online Virus and Spyware Scan - Trend Micro USA (check the list for OS compatibility). After using such a scanner to make sure your computer is virus free you should install a local virus scan product (search Free Software Downloads and Software Reviews - Download.com for Avast and AVG).

    You should also install anti spyware/adware software like Spybot Search and Destroy or Ad Aware (search Free Software Downloads and Software Reviews - Download.com)
